Program Summary for Bastrop Housing Authority

Bastrop Housing Authority is a public housing agency that helps provide decent and safe rental housing for eligible low-income families, the elderly, and persons with disabilities. Bastrop Housing Authority manages several funded programs and has a total of 50 subsidized affordable housing units for rental assistance. Bastrop Housing Authority administered a total of 22 Section 8 Vouchers. Bastrop Housing Authority currently has low rent units and Section 8 Voucher as its program type. Bastrop Housing Authority is located at 502 Farm Street, Bastrop, TX, 78602 and serves the city of Bastrop. Income limits, fair market rents and rent rates vary with each agency. Please contact Bastrop Housing Authority at, (512) 321-3398 for more information about coverage area and program availability.

Additional Information

They do not have Section 8 vouchers, that program will be closed to apply for, for several years. You can apply for Public Housing and be put on to a waiting list. If you are in Bastrop you can stop by the office at 502 Farm St. hours of operation are M-Th 8:30 a.m.-12:00 p.m.-1:30 p.m.-5:30 p.m. If you are interested in applying and live outside of Bastrop you can call them to request an application. About Bastrop Housing Authority

Bastrop Housing Authority offer Public Housing and Housing Choice Vouchers but we are only accepting applications for our public housing program.

We are accepting applications for public housing and the estimated wait is 1 to 1 ½ years depending on vacancies.

Unfortunately, the waiting list for HCV has been closed since 2006 and individuals on the list before it closed are still waiting for assistance.

Our services cover City of Bastrop and within 10 miles of city limits, if it does not cross into another Housing Authority's jurisdiction.

2017 Fair Market Rents for Bastrop County, TX

Fair Market Rents are HUD's determination of the average rents in a particular area for each bedroom size. The FMRs are set each year based on the rental rates of unsubsidized units so that participants in HUD programs have equal access for affordable housing. Here are the Fair Market Rents for Bastrop County, TX:

  • Efficiency
  • $799
  • One-Bedroom
  • $968
  • Two-Bedroom
  • $1195
  • Three-Bedroom
  • $1619
  • Four-Bedroom
  • $1948
